Iran is slowly getting back on track. Amidst the threats from Israel and America, it is not only responding to these countries, but is also moving ahead in space research. Recently, it has successfully tested a satellite launch rocket Qased. This is Iran’s first major and successful test after Israel’s 12-day military attacks. Experts also believe that this is a rocket for the world, but in reality its technology is based on ballistic missile which can become a big strength for Iran.
Amidst the strict monitoring of Iran’s missile program and the instability emerging in the Middle East, this rocket test is being considered a big achievement of Iran. According to Iran’s government news agency Mehr, this launch will be useful in assessing new technologies and improving the performance of satellite systems.
The rocket can be converted into a missile
The rocket that Iran has tested uses a combination of solid and liquid fuel, which makes it capable of being converted into an ICBM i.e. Intercontinental Ballistic Missile in the future. This claim has been made in a report by the Institute for Study of War. A similar thing has been said in a report by Breaking Defense, which says that space launch vehicles like Qased can lead to the development of ICBMs quickly. Apart from this, this is also a test of Iran’s new technology, which can be applied in satellite launch or rocket system in future. This technology will improve missile control and guidance. Earlier, when such launches have taken place, they have been sharply criticized by Western countries. American Republican Senator Tom Cotton called this launch of Iran deceptive.

Qased is a hybrid rocket
Iran’s Qased rocket is a hybrid fuel satellite rocket, its first launch took place in 2020, when it successfully delivered a military satellite to its destination. In the recent test, no satellite was launched, but improvements in the design have been certified. According to Iran’s news agency IRNA, the purpose of this test is to test new technologies so that the country’s space capabilities can be further improved.
